Budget

1. Budget looks good. Ms. Perry moved some things around to make the budget work.

2. We will be transferring funds so that we zero out negative balances.

a. Yearbook made a lot of money, so we will be able to transfer $4216 to Student Council. (see attachment #1) Yearbook going with cheaper company and charged a bit more AND yearbooks are nice!

b. Transferring $2,692 from emergency savings. (see attachment #1)

            c. Transferring $3390 from General Fund. (see attachment #1)

d. We have been spending $11,000 on Referees every year with student body paying for $5000 of it. Joe Ginanni has agreed to use the money from the City of Palo Alto to pay the whole amount. (See attachment #2)

7. Proposed budget last year was about $40,000. Now after zeroing out, we will need to allocate $19,617. Magazine drive will generate this money.

8.Voted on new budget, all 7 members approved the budget. One member (Michael Y.) was not present and did not vote.

9. David L., Treasurer, signed transfer of fund approvals.

 

Magazine Drive

1. Assemblies September 15.

2. After assemblies, magazine drive runs for two weeks.

3. Have posters up next week so people are informed of the fundraiser before the assembly. Give people a heads up.

 

4. Sharon Ofek, VP arrived approx. 12:45. She says that:

a.     Bulk of sales come from 6th graders, want 8th graders to participate more.

b.     Proposed a special incentive for 8th graders. Turn in day?

c.     JUST FOR 8th GRADERS – leave school at about 11:00 to go to Giants game vs. Arizona. Turn in a certain amount of subscriptions and you can go. Open to the first 45 kids.

d.     Baseball game is September 27.

e.     The idea is that the students would be going with friends, not parents.

f.      Not doing limo ride this year.

g.     ALSO - If everyone in an advisory class sold just one subscription, then theyÕd get a prize -  7th and 8th graders only.

h.     Finalize prize schedule by the end of the week.

 

5. Vote on baseball game as 8th grade incentive, 7 members approve the baseball game as 8th grade Magazine Drive incentive. Michael Y. was not present and did not vote.
